Paver Driveway Construction Questions
What types of pavers are suitable for driveways? Concrete, brick, and natural stone pavers are common options, each offering different styles and durability levels for driveways.
How long does a paver driveway typically last? Properly installed paver driveways can last several decades with minimal maintenance, depending on usage and climate conditions.
Are paver driveways resistant to cracking? Yes, pavers are designed to flex slightly, which helps prevent cracking compared to traditional concrete slabs.
What maintenance is needed for a paver driveway? Regular cleaning and occasional re-sanding of joints help maintain appearance and stability over time.
